Manchester City pair Erling Haaland and Nathan Ake trained with the group ahead of Saturday's Premier League clash at home to Liverpool.
The Blues pair have both been doubts for the lunchtime kick-off after withdrawing from international duty for their respective nations.
Ake missed the 4-4 draw at Chelsea before the break due to an unspecified injury. Haaland was with Norway but suffered a recurrence of the ankle issue that saw him forced off against Bournemouth at the start of the month.
He finished the game against the Faroe Islands, a 2-0 win, but did not feature against Scotland on Sunday.
